If you are asking in the context of the Entrepreneur category visa, then the answer is NO. If you are asking for Skilled Migrant Residence, then also, the answer is NO. If you are investing in the company you work for, your employment may be challenged as not genuine as you are paying a premium/investing money into the company. There is a direct conflict of interest for the company to offer you the employment and thus such an application is likely to be declined.
